How can I tell if my Kansas home needs new windows?

If you notice drafts, condensation, or difficulty operating your windows, it's likely time for an upgrade in Kansas. Older windows often struggle to keep up with our significant temperature swings, leading to higher energy bills. Look for visible signs of wear or rot.

Are permits typically required for window installation in Kansas?

Permitting requirements can differ by city and county within Kansas. While some straightforward replacements might not require a permit, it's always wise to confirm with your local building authority. We ensure all installations comply with local codes.
